Key Responsibilities:
- Manage all property-related administrative tasks including lease agreements, renewals, documentation, and filing.
- Act as the main point of contact for tenants; address queries, complaints, and coordinate necessary resolutions.
- Conduct regular inspections of properties to ensure upkeep and compliance with safety standards.
- Coordinate and oversee maintenance, repairs, and service contractors to ensure timely and satisfactory completion of work.
- Monitor rent collections, follow up on outstanding payments, and coordinate with finance as needed.
- Maintain accurate records of property conditions, incidents, and communications.
- Provide support during tenant move-in and move-out processes.
